繁体   English   中英

Python 编辑和更新 Excel/Csv 文件

[英]Python Editing and Updating Excel/Csv File

因此,我正在尝试创建一个程序,该程序将为我提供某个字母序列中的下一个值。 例如,A4 或 B8 或 C23。 我相信最简单的方法是创建一个 CSV 文件并在 Python 中引用该文件并更新它。 但我在做这件事时遇到了麻烦。 我能得到一些帮助吗? 我正在使用 Spyder/anaconda。 程序将询问用户想要什么字母,并给出该字母序列中的下一个值。

我建议使用openpyxl库。 您可以使用它来获取和编辑 csv 或电子表格中的值。 你可以像这样使用它:

from openpyxl import load_workbook
wb = load_workbook(filename = 'yourSpreadsheet.xlsx') #select file
ws = wb.active #select worksheet
a4 = ws['A4'] #get contents of cell A4
ws['A5'] = a4 + 1 #set cell A5 to the value of cell A4+1
wb.save('resultSheet.xlsx')

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M